About the course

Unfortunately, this course was clearly abandoned and is unfinished. However, all 9 baskets are in, as well as a practice basket near hole 1's "tee". If you're willing to rough it, a fun little course.

Okay, here me out. Absolutely abandoned course clearly for many years. Overgrown and incomplete... BUT there are in fact 9 baskets and even a practice basket! No teepads and only 4 with rough tee signs. There is a 3-3.5 star course hidden here, and with a lot of love and work from Mayville, this could genuinely be an enjoyable 9 hole. With some nice wooded holes and some open, some longer holes and some short technical shots, I would love to see this fleshed out into the well intentioned course it was meant to be.
